"Compass of Tomorrow" reform launches amid teacher disappointment over funding
Poland's "Compass of Tomorrow" education reform officially launched on 1 September, introducing new subjects and a ban on smartphones. Teachers and school principals report deep disappointment, citing a lack of funding for the promised changes and last-minute planning done overnight. The Education Ministry promised a 21st-century school, but the reality in corridors and classrooms falls well short of those declarations.
